Today is the Autumnal Equinox, meaning the sun’s direct rays start dipping south of the equator. It also marks the first official day of Fall. However, temperatures will be staying very summer-like through the weekend and the beginning of next week. Temperatures will be around 15 degrees above normal with muggy air. Sunshine stays in the forecast until Tuesday. We start to see temperatures drop and feel Fall-like next Wednesday.
Tonight: Clear, low 67.
Saturday: Sunny, high of 90.
Sunday: Sunny, highs in the upper 80s.
